When we sleep our muscles are put into a sort of flaccid mode and do not respond to movement messages. You can often see a sleeping person or animal twitching, and in their dreams they are doing a lot of activity.

Our brains react to the alarming dream episode in the usual "run out of the way" response, but we lack the response from the limbs that anything is happening (because nothing is!) and so we think we are unable to run. To avoid the danger we resort to flying, burrowing under the ground or some other fantastical escape.
